Google's Daydream View Is a VR Eye Pillow
Released on 10/04/2016
(happy piano music)
Google's first VR headset was just
a piece of cardboard.
This is better.
This is called the Daydream View
and it's first of probably many viewers
for virtual reality that are going to
support this new breed of Android phones
that's coming out.
So it's really two pieces.
The first is the controller,
which is this little pebble of a thing
that has a a clicky trackpad and two buttons.
But it's mostly a motion controller
so you can use it to slash or swipe or point at stuff.
This is really how you do everything in Daydream.
The headset is much simpler, really.
It's just a headset.
It has some technology so that
when you put your phone in it uses
NFC to automatically pair and will
instantly launch you into the Daydream home
where you can do the VR thing.
It also works to automatically align it,
but the biggest thing it is, is just, comfortable.
It's really light and sort of plushy and smushy
and the whole goal was to make it
feel like clothing, not like a gadget.
So when you put it on,
I mean, you still look ridiculous but
it feels better and it feels more natural somehow.
Google's whole plan is to make VR
feel accessible and that's by making it
easy to wear and inexpensive, this things only $80,
and about making it feel comfortable and nice,
not like a gadget.
The Daydream View goes a long way towards that.
